Hi Marla — the uniform order for the new Tarnbeck depot came in from Stitchvale this morning: 24 sets, sized per Devi's list. They're boxed in the storeroom, labelled by shift. A courier collects them Thursday. The hand-over instruction you'll need to pass along is noted just below this.

handover note for yagef-bagep: the drudor pelius courier leaves the kasdor zorvan norir ledger at gate 8016 under passcode 755406

## Account Recovery — Eventspire Schema Registry

Scope: locked or orphaned admin accounts on the Eventspire registry (the service that validates all event schemas for the Dunmore pipeline). Do not create a new admin account; it breaks schema ownership records. Instead: stop the registry writer, boot the node in recovery mode, and run the account-restore tool from the ops bundle. It re-links the admin identity to the existing schema catalog. The tool asks two confirmation questions, then prompts for the recovery passphrase, which is:

recovery phrase for fajeg-hagug: holox-fenmir

Minutes — Management Meeting, Branholt Office

Present: Orla Fenwick (chair), D. Castellane, R. Imbry.

The sales leads' budget request for the Marrowgate pilot was reviewed in detail. Travel and demo-kit costs were approved in principle; the headcount line was deferred pending the revenue forecast. Fenwick will confirm figures next week.

Attendees were asked to note the following item.

confidential, kagup-bafog: Fraaxax Group is in early talks to buy Soroxox Group for about $343.8 million. The Olidor launch date is June 14, and nothing goes to the press before then. Legal wants the Aldmirek Logistics term sheet signed before July 23.

[ ] Verify Graphlight dependency visualizer renders cyclic graphs without the layout freeze seen in the Marrow release. Load the Tindervale monorepo fixture, confirm render under 4s, and check that orphan nodes are greyed out rather than hidden. Export SVG and compare against the golden snapshot. Sign off only if all three pass. Record results against the build token appended below.

pipeline stamp: htk9_6ce9d33c5